Hi,

24x7 architecture is - master scheduler on "server1" running as service
using defined admin account and configured with distributed server mode enabled.
"server2" has 24x7 remote agent installed running as service but without distributed server mode enabled.

I create jobs on console on "server1" and schedule them to run on "server2" default queue.

The problem I have is that I do not see any Job Log information on "server1" - what am I doing wrong ?and
how should things be configured to allow this centralised creation, scheduling and monitoring of the jobs - both local run and remote ?

Also once a job has been defined on "server1" what is the easy way
to reschedule a job for execution on another server and/or queue - say "server3"

In 24x7 agent the server part is activated automatically you don't need to check the "server mode" option.

What do you call a "console" - 24x7 Remote Control or the GUI started on the "server1" computer while the services is running?
How do you check the job log?

To change job queue or target server simply change job queue property or job agent/host property. After you save change the job will be assigned to specified queue and agent. Please note that queue and agent are not related properties and they can be set separately.

I mean the GUI and I have noticed that Ican actually view the job log -
it's just that I seem to have to exit the GUI and re-enter before the job log shows up.

Also as the GUI is a "second" instance of 24x7 I can't use the job/que monitors ?

Jim

Use the refresh button or View/Refresh menu to refresh the log. Without restarting the console.

That's right you can't use it for monitoring because it is not attached to the service. It is not a console to the service; in other words, it is just a standalone GUI.
For interactive job monitoring you can use either 24x7 Remote Control or 24x7 web-based interface. In remote console you can pending and running job. In the web-based interface you can monitor both pending and running jobs and also job queues.

You can also enable real-time HTML reports option to monitor job logs using just your web browser.
